Lay down your rights

September 2, 2010

Therefore go out from their midst, and be separate from them, says the Lord, and touch no unclean thing; then I will welcome you…

--2 Corinthians 6:17

If a stranger looked at your life objectively, would they come to the conclusion that you are a follower of Christ? Take into consideration what your tastes in entertainment say about you. What about your language, ethics, and relationships. 

Now, what I'm about to say is essential if you and I intend to serve Christ: We are called to separate ourselves from the world.

You see, it's impossible to make a difference in the world if we're not different! I'll even go a step further. The churches and Christians who are most like the world are the ones that do the least amount of good for Christ Jesus!

Do you know why? It's because these people love themselves more than they care about a lost and dying world. It's tragic and it's true. There are people who call themselves Christians who'd rather have their own way and secret vices than to align themselves completely with Christ and to stand for him.

What about you? Are you willing to lay down your own rights and wishes in order to be a light to your friends and family? Jesus said, "Greater love has no one than this, that someone lay down his life for his friends."

Come out from among the world and become a messenger of Christ's transforming power!
